If you are or plan to be a "frequent cruiser", joining a cruise club may be the thing for you.
Cruise clubs offer not only the chance of cheaper prices but deals that may come with a lot of extras and special privileges that can make your cruise even that much more enjoyable.
There are a couple of different types of cruise clubs. There are those that are offered by cruise specialists who can find the best deals from all of the top cruise lines. Your membership not only gets you the cruise of your dreams booked, but tips on everything cruise-related like how get ready for your trip. Their websites are full of handy information including reviews and advice from other club members about their experiences.
Other benefits of cruise clubs like this can sometimes include the best deals on getting foreign currency. You might even get to go aboard a ship before booking to get a feel for what the cabins are like, sample the food, and check out all of the other amenities.
Joining a club dedicated to cruising like this is normally free and gets you the latest news about special cruise offers, usually much lower than the prices shown on cruise line brochures. A cruise booked through a club can include free cabin upgrades, free parking at airports or port parking lots.
Another type of cruise club are those offered by individual cruise line. They give free memberships to their cruise clubs after you sail with them for the first time. Some of these cruise line specific clubs are the Carnival Past Guest Recognition Program, Disney’s different levels of their Castaway Club, the MSC club and the Royal Caribbean Crown and Anchor Society. The more you sail with a cruise line, the more club benefits you are likely to have. Some of the many benefits of this style of cruise club include:
· Early notification of special offers.
· Discounts on suites and staterooms.
· Early booking – This allows you to be one of the first to book new cruises offered by the cruise line.
· Priority planning lets you book early for shore excursions, spa and salon treatments, and other activities on the cruise.
· Priority check in lets you be among the first to board.
Onboard benefits include:
· Discounts towards merchandise purchased on board.
· A special gift waiting in your cabin.
· Private parties for members only.
· Even more savings if you book your next cruise on board.
Most of these clubs allow you to accumulate points for things like booking with that cruise line and purchasing upgrades. These points can be used for discounts on future cruises.
